[[quoteright:320:https://static.tvtropes.org/pmwiki/pub/images/adoptcalypse_now_title_card_6.png]]


Mac and Bloo try to save their friends from getting adopted on Adopt-a-Thought Saturday.

----
!!Tropes:

* BodyWipe:
** Happens twice in a row when Mac chases Coco.
** Where Bloo is running away from a group of kids.
* HalfDressedCartoonAnimal: [[LampshadeHanging Lampshaded]]; while Mac claims to Mr. Herriman that he's bringing Coco in because she's embarrassed about being nude(he's really trying to avoid her being adopted), Herriman points out that most imaginary friends are nude. Mac calls him "Pantless Joe" in response, prompting Herriman to [[HandOrObjectUnderwear cover his (offscreen) crotch.]] He's seen wearing a pair of overalls the rest of the episode.
* IdiotBall: Mac apparently didn't know that imaginary friends were supposed to be adopted. He learned this in ''the very first episode''.
* OperationBlank: Parodied with "Operation Eight-legged-drop-big-purple-scaredy-cat-run-and-scramble" or, in layman's terms:
-->'''Bloo:''' We're going to drop this big spider on Eduardo, he'll freak out, and everyone will run away.
* SquashedFlat: Bloo, when a giant, gorilla-like imaginary friend is launched through the window and lands on him.
